Leo: Strength/Lust

Strength/Lust, whose esoteric title is “The Daughter of the Flaming Sword, Leader of the Lion,” symbolizes successfully overcoming a situation through courage and strength with a passionate will.

Cancer: The Chariot

The Chariot, whose esoteric title is “The Child of the Powers of the Waters, Lord of the Triumph of Light,” symbolizes successful control over opposing forces through mastery, willpower, and determination…

Gemini: The Lovers

The Lovers, whose esoteric title is “Children of the Voice, The Oracles of the Mighty Gods,” is generally considered a card of marriage or commitment to a life-altering relationship.

Taurus: The Heirophant

The Hierophant, whose esoteric title is “Magus of the Eternal Gods,” is considered the counterpart of the High Priestess. Organizational structures in all forms are suggested, whether religious, business, or relational.

Leo Decan 3: Valor

The Seven of Wands represents the third decan of Leo, often referred to as the Lord of Valor. This particular card represents the fiery ambition that characterizes the 15th decan of the solar year.
